Wood and Engineered Wood: Classic Yet Sustainable
All-natural timber floor covering stays a classic option for home owners who value heat and toughness. While solid hardwood is a sustainable option when sourced sensibly, engineered wood is getting appeal because of its reliable use of natural resources. With its split building and construction, engineered wood lowers waste while maintaining the beauty of standard wood.
Sourcing timber from responsibly handled woodlands guarantees that your flooring financial investment does not add to logging. Additionally, some engineered flooring items are made from recycled timber fibers, further enhancing their environment-friendly allure.
Bamboo and Cork: The New Era of Sustainable Flooring
Bamboo and cork floor covering have actually emerged as two of the most sustainable options offered today. Bamboo, a highly renewable energy, proliferates and supplies resilience comparable to hardwood. It's a stylish choice that offers strength against dampness and wear, making it an excellent selection for high-traffic locations.
Cork, on the other hand, is gathered from the bark of cork oak trees without hurting the tree itself. This natural product is soft underfoot, making it an outstanding option for homes that prioritize convenience. It additionally has all-natural shielding residential or commercial properties, helping to manage indoor temperature levels while reducing noise.
